Hsp90, the 90 kDa heat shock protein, is a highly expressed molecular chaperone that modulates the stability and/or transport of a diverse set of critical cellular regulatory proteins. Among Hsp90 clients are a number of proteins, which in a cell type-dependent manner, contribute to tumor cell radioresistance. Auranofin (AF) is an anti-arthritic drug considered for combined chemotherapy due to its ability to impair the redox homeostasis in tumor cells. In this study, we asked whether AF may in addition radiosensitize tumor cells by targeting thioredoxin reductase (TrxR), a critical enzyme in the antioxidant defense system operating through the reductive protein thioredoxin.
